Re: [AVR-Chat] Demise of win XP (was: New poll for AVR-Chat)

2012-09-26 by John Samperi

At 10:05 PM 26/09/2012, you wrote:
>I understand that MicroSoft is ending support for XP soon,
>but could you clarify what you mean by the "demise of win XP", please?

It will be similar to what happened when win 98 stopped being supported.
I had to upgrade my laptop to win XP as the anti-virus I was using stopped
supporting win 98. Then AVR Studio was no longer supporting win 98 etc.

I was also hoping to use win XP indefinitely but unfortunately the reality
is that you can't really work with newer tools if one sticks to older O/S.

And yes I get cranky too that I will need to eventually throw away 2 perfectly
working desktop computers which may not be able to run win 7 or the soon to be
released win 8.

Just got a new laptop on Monday running win 7 as my old laptop is not really
able to run AS6 which is required if one wants to attend Atmel's seminars in
November in Australia.

It took 2.5 hours of downloads, updates and installs before AS6 was 
ready to run.
